Culligan sanitisers earned safety approval from Municipality.

Culligan Center East has made safety approval from an independent research study expert for the sanitiser created in the UAE when the company created a new product line in response to the Covid-19 pandemic.

The surface and skin contact sanitiser was adapted through a lab procedure in Dubai from one of Culligan's range of water therapy products made use of in the supply of water to sector hospitals, hotels as well as houses across the region.

It has a base of hypochlorous acid, a substance the body's white blood cells create normally to fight infection, and Culligan appointed a record on the product by UK-based Equipment, a leading study organisation being experts in dermatology and ophthalmology.

The record ended that the Culligan sanitiser certified as being "extremely efficient for sanitation" and was "particularly ideal for ecological disinfection applications, such as reducing ecological transmission of viruses in between people."

Culligan SafeGuard 45 H 25 has also been tested and passed by Dubai Central Laboratory and certified both by the Emirates Authority For Standardization & Metrology and Dubai Municipality.

"As a responsible company, our priority is always to ensure that our products are safe and effective," said Culligan Middle East technical director, Rodger Macfarlane. "The safety report is testimony to the dedication of our laboratory team, and the hard work of our production team, to develop the sanitiser from an existing water treatment product in the space of two weeks."
